プレミアム業務自動化
N8N × Claude APIで記事自動生成ワークフローを構築する
·2 min read·Nexeed Lab
N8NClaude API自動化ワークフロー
N8Nの自動化ワークフローとClaude APIを組み合わせて、SEO最適化された記事を自動生成するシステムの構築手順を解説します。
はじめに
この記事では、N8NとClaude APIを使って記事を自動生成するワークフローを一から構築します。完成すると、スケジュール実行で毎日自動的にSEO最適化された記事が生成されます。
全体アーキテクチャ
Schedule Trigger(毎日9時)
↓
Google Sheets(キーワードリスト取得)
↓
Claude API(記事生成)
↓
WordPress REST API(記事投稿)
↓
LINE Notify(完了通知)
ステップ1:N8Nのセットアップ
まず、N8Nの環境を準備します。Railway上にセルフホストする方法が最もコスパが良いです。
Railwayでのデプロイ手順
- Railwayアカウントを作成
- New Project → Docker Image を選択
- イメージに
n8nio/n8nを指定 - 環境変数を設定
N8N_BASIC_AUTH_ACTIVE=true
N8N_BASIC_AUTH_USER=admin
N8N_BASIC...